图书介绍
80286软硬件系统剖析PDF|Epub|txt|kindle电子书版本网盘下载
![80286软硬件系统剖析](https://www.shukui.net/cover/67/32168800.jpg)
- 北京中国科学院希望电脑技术公司编 著
- 出版社: 中国科学院希望高级电脑技术公司
- ISBN:
- 出版时间:未知
- 标注页数:172页
- 文件大小:5MB
- 文件页数:182页
- 主题词:
PDF下载
下载说明
80286软硬件系统剖析P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
目录1
序言1
第一章 80286与这本书1
关于802861
关于80286的结构1
80286的性能2
关于这本书3
第二章 任务切换与特权层的介绍5
能干的2865
现行特权层6
现行任务6
软件设计的新环境7
多任务的利用7
特权层的利用8
系统设计映入于微处理器结构9
利用属性精细调整你的系统9
从一个任务转到另一个9
为程序设计师提供的一个小指令10
处理机的一大步10
特权阶层控制任务的存取性(Accessibility)10
协处理器与多任务10
通往较高特权层的闸路(Gate ways)11
在较高层所附加的特权11
横向式特权层11
透明的特权转移12
复习80286的任务与特权层13
整体新结构的摘要13
第三章 简介实地址模式与保护的虚地址模式15
实地址模式:给8086软件使用的真实地址15
可以定行8086/8088目的码,并且更快速16
8086/8088的指令超集(Super set)16
架起到达保护模式的桥梁16
启动受保护的虚拟地址模式16
FSETPM17
原始程序代码的兼容性18
保护模式启动全部的结构18
保护的虚拟地址模式:新的能力19
描述器担任重要角色19
为保护模式发展用的新的通用软件20
第四章 应用程序设计的资源21
资源概况21
处理器与协处理器的资源22
寄存器资源22
80286通用寄存器22
80287通用寄存器24
数据寄存器的堆栈安排24
89286的段寄存器25
FADD ST ST(2)25
80286的指令指针26
80286的状态字26
应用寄存器总结28
数据存取时的寻址方式28
指定操作数的地址28
从存储中存取数据29
暂时性使用的寄存器模式29
静态变量用的直接内存模式30
方便用于常数的立即模式31
用于矩阵元素的间接寄存器模式32
直接内存模式用于大多数的分支指令34
寻址模式用于程序流程34
间接内存模式用于跳转与调用表中35
间接寄存器寻址选用动态传递的指针35
数据的类型36
给操作数说明与配置内存空间37
布系数37
有符号的整数37
无符号的整数39
浮点数39
地址的指针40
本章摘要40
系统需要的特殊资源43
第五章 系统程序设计人员的资源43
80286系统寄存器的使用44
中断描述器表寄存器(IDTR)45
机器状态字46
任务寄存器49
局部描述器表寄存器(LDTR)50
80287系统寄存器的使用50
控制字51
用于自动例外处理的设定52
状态字54
便笺字(Tag word)55
指令指针与数据指针55
系统资源摘要与展望56
第六章 内存的管理58
CPU与MMU58
描述器59
依需要而驱动的虚拟内存59
实现的方法60
虚拟内存用于多任务60
内存的程序观点63
段的限制检查65
虚拟内存操作系统67
摘要68
保护与特权70
第七章 保护特征的使用70
保护的重要性70
特权级的表示71
特权层的各种用途72
基本的保护特征73
段的限制检查73
属性检查74
设定特殊用途74
操作系统的保护75
层的保护规则75
调用闸门77
在层间转移的堆栈动作78
内部的转移78
当使用参数自动复制特征时80
一般的系统保护80
I/O的特权层81
设计IOPL的建议83
MMU提供任务之间的保护83
保护特征摘要84
第八章 多任务与任务切换86
多任务的基础86
任务状态段87
任务信息块的一部分89
TSS的详细内容90
设定任务状态段92
设计一个简单的任务94
任务选择器表94
高级的任务课题95
任务闸门97
任务切换位97
嵌套式任务与任务链接98
忙与闲的任务99
如何依靠结构建立系统软件100
机制与策略之间的关系101
用于机制/策略分离的结构支持101
策略101
机制101
多任务结构摘要102
有关多任务的进一步消息102
第九章 异常与中断103
用于高优先事件的处理方法103
为什么要提供中断的能力?103
异常的发展104
我们需要处理的80286的异常情况105
“好的”异常105
异常与中断的机制106
中断向量表106
“坏的”异常106
异常槽位的指定107
NMI及INTR信号109
NMT的自动指向109
INTR的动态指向110
可重复执行性110
可重新执行的指令111
异常的改正111
设立一个中断描述器表111
用于IDT的闸门:中断、陷境及任务111
中断式的结构113
在中断、陷井与任务闸门之间做决定113
高级的中断课题113
中断任务的结构114
用于CPU异常的闸门114
0:除法错误115
1 :单步执行115
6:无效的操作码116
7:数字协处理器无效116
8:双重失误116
9:数学协处理器的操作数部分超出段限制116
10:无效的任务状态段116
12:堆栈段不存在或违反堆栈段限制(堆栈失误)117
11:程序代码段、数据段与辅助段不存在117
13:一般的保护违犯118
16:数学协处理器计算错误118
至31号的其余异常118
中断与异常总结118
第十章 80286的应用121
由重置到保护模式的程序121
可写在EPROM中的程序121
以可观察方式定义描述器121
第一个程序例子:具有异常处理程序的简单保护模式122
程序例子:多工作范例123
系统框图155
完全测试过的硬件设计155
第十一章 构造并检测一个以80286为基础的系统155
核心:处理器与支持元件156
82284脉冲产生器156
80286CPU与82288总线控制器156
焦点: 80286的总线周期159
EPROM、静态RAM、及外设接口160
零件布置图及电路图162
硬件诊断指示162
KISS的原理162
LED的显示168
简单的诊断软件169
诊断如何执行170